Case Study: Management of automotive parts through heat treatment processes

Object | Jig for heat treatment of aluminum parts |
Temperature | 250℃ x several hours |
Products | HP-L80 HP-T42 HP-CBR Tag |
Customer’s request
- Improve product tracking systems and inventory control using barcodes

Initial Process Management
Paper tag was used which did not provide durable identification and could not survive heat processes
HEATPROOF Solution

1 | Eliminate the need to re-identify parts after heat treatment processes |
2 | HEATPROOF labels and tags can survive multiple heat processes and are reused |
3 | Improve product tracking systems and verify parts identity using barcode scanners |
